30 yard dumpster dimensions in Revere

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be receiving a container which will hold 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could change somewhat determined by the dumpster rental business in Revere you select. A 30 yard dumpster will hold between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, so it is an excellent choice for whole-house residential cleanouts in addition to commercial clean-up projects.

Examples of projects that would generate enough waste for a 30 yard container include:

  • A leading house improvement
  • Building of a brand new house
  • A garage demolition
  • Whole-house window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size house)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limitation or you could face overage charges.


20 yard dumpster dimensions in Revere

A 20 yard dumpster can carry about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Ordinary d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can carry about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This implies that the 20-yarder is a familiar size for jobs that involve cleanup from larger projects.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a good volume of debris, a 20 yard container is one of the most famous dumpster sizes for home jobs.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container include:

  • Cleanup from a basement, attic or garage
  • Flooring and carpet removal from a big house
  • 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
  • 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Revere

When you rent a dumpster in Revere, you are d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. As you probably do not use these terms every day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ually enable you to cope with business employees who may get impatient should you not realize what they're describing about their products.

"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ually leased in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to include the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for example, you want to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Use these terms, and you will seem like a pro when you call.


40 yard dumpster measurements

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ions are not totally con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the largest size that most dumpster businesses usually rent, so it is perfect for large residential projects as well as for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a big dwelling
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major addition to a sizable dwelling
  • Substantial am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Bag

Dumpster bags may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this alternative works well for you, though, will depend on your project.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al option that works for you.

Roll Off Dumpsters

It's hard to overcome a roll off dumpster when you have a large undertaking that'll create a lot of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you could av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ters generally have time limitations because businesses need to get them back for other customers. This is a potential downside if you aren't good at meeting deadlines.

Dumpster Bags

Dumpster bags are often suitable for small occupations with loose deadlines. In case you don't need a lot of room for debris, then the bags could function nicely for you. Many companies are also pleased to allow you to keep the bags for so long as you want. That makes them useful for longer projects.

10 yard dumpster measurements in Revere

A 10 yard dumpster is built to carry 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ure approximately 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will change with different firms.

It may be difficult to choose exactly the container size you will need for your home job,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ller cleaning occupations.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would carry:

  •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that has been removed
  • A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
  • The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job

If your job is big en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you do not want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
